The Microsoft PL-100 exam focuses on various aspects of the Microsoft Power Platform, including Power Apps, Power Automate, Power BI, and Power Virtual Agents. PL-100 exam covers topics such as creating custom connectors, building model-driven and canvas apps, creating workflows, building chatbots, and analyzing data with Power BI. PL-100 exam also evaluates the candidate’s ability to design solutions that meet specific business requirements and integrate with other systems. Passing the Microsoft PL-100 exam can help professionals to enhance their career prospects and open up new opportunities in the field of app development and business automation.


Exam Details

The Microsoft PL-100 exam contains about 40-50 questions and lasts for 90-120 minutes. It costs $165 for the candidates who take this test in the United States. If you are located in another country, this pricing can be different for you. So, before registering for the exam, check the actual cost on the certification webpage. The test is proctored by Pearson VUE and is available in the English language only.

Box 1: Check the number of items in the collection
If the data in your data source exceeds 500 records and a function can't be delegated, Power Apps might not be able to retrieve all of the data, and your app may have wrong results.
Note: Delegation is where the expressiveness of Power Apps formulas meets the need to minimize data moving over the network. In short, Power Apps will delegate the processing of data to the data source, rather than moving the data to the app for processing locally.
Box 2: Use the Advanced Tools/Monitor feature
Monitor is available by default for all canvas apps. Using Monitor, you can trace events as they occur in a canvas app during the authoring experience in Power Apps Studio, or you can use Monitor to debug the published version of a canvas app.
Example: Consider the scenario where an app has been deployed, and the initial version of the app experiences performance degradation. The app also intermittently generates errors with no clear pattern. Loading data in the app succeeds most of the time, but fails sometimes.
When you check Monitor, you see data operations as expected. However, you also see several responses that have HTTP status code 429, indicating that there have been too many requests in a specific timeframe.

Box 1: Component library
Components are reusable building blocks for canvas apps so that app makers can create custom controls to use inside an app, or across apps using a component library. Components can use advanced features such as custom properties and enable complex capabilities.
By creating a component library, app makers easily share and update one or more components with other makers.
Component libraries are containers of component definitions that make it easy to:
Discover and search components.
Publish updates.
Notify app makers of available component updates.
Box 2: Component
A component can receive input values and emit data if you create one or more custom properties.
